Subject: 11.22 BUSINESS: Award of E-Rate Services Agreement With SigmaNet Incorporated for the Purchase and Installation of Firewall Equipment (funded through the General Fund)

Summary: In support of the District’s network and the demands of Scholar+, it is recommended that DIstrict purchase, install, configure, test and place into production a next generation firewall in the District’s Network Operations Center. The District's teachers and students continue to increase the use of technology, specifically the consumption of online resources, in the classroom. This increase in demand to provide additional bandwidth, coupled with the need to provide a safe and secure online environment for our students and the District’s data necessitate updates to the District’s networking hardware. The District is well positioned to meet these needs and has planned for continued growth according to the metrics developed by the State Educational Technology Directors Association (SETDA), part of this plan is the upgrade of various networking components, one of which is the upgrade to a Next Generation Firewall. Additionally, the purchase of the Next Generation Firewall is, in large part, funded through the Federal Communication Commission's E-Rate program which makes telecommunications and information services more affordable for eligible schools.

The Next Generation Firewall provides traditional networking protection in addition to more granular visibility and control of the data that is traversing the District's network.

The purchase, configuration and installation of the Next Generation Firewall is paramount to successfully meeting the increasing demands of Scholar+ and the use of the District's network in general.

The successful implementation of the Next Generation Firewall will help ensure that the District provides a safe and secure online environment for students and the data maintained by the
District.

The Next Generation Firewall will service network traffic for all schools in District.

The selected contractor for the project is Sigmanet Incorporated, which proposed pricing off of CMAS Contract #3‐15‐70‐2486F. The proposed pricing from the California Multiple Award Schedules (CMAS) is established for information technology and non-information technology products and services that have been competitively assessed, negotiated, or bid primarily by the federal General Services Administration, but not exclusively. The contracts are structured to comply with California procurement codes, guidelines, and policies, and provide for the highest level of contractual protection.

Utilization of the contract is contingent upon approved funding for the 2017-18 E-Rate year and the District is under no obligation to proceed with the recommended contract. Costs to the District can be discounted from 60 percent to 90 percent dependent upon the service and District eligibility.

Public Contract Code (PCC) Sections 10290 et seq. and 12101.5 include approval for local government agencies to use CMAS for acquisition of information technology and non-information technology products and services.
